The Holodomor (a man-made famine) of 1932–1933, which claimed millions of lives, was a deliberate policy by the Soviet Union aimed at destroying the Ukrainian nation. This is supported by hundreds of witness accounts, historical documents, and diary entries, which continue to be studied by historians. In this way, Stalin sought to pacify Ukrainian peasants, who had widely protested against forced collectivisation and risen up against the Soviet regime. Deprived of any food, people were forced to eat wild plants. Moreover, in the rare instances when a small amount of grain or vegetables was found, they had to figure out how to make it last for the entire family. In this videos, we share the memories of Ukrainians survivors of the genocide, reflecting on their experiences with food during the Holodomor.

On June 6, 2023, Russia blew up the Kakhovka Dam, flooding communities and impacting nearly a million people. This video examines how the dam’s destruction fits a wider pattern: Russia’s deliberate targeting of civilian infrastructure across Ukraine.
